#de216d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#de216d is composed of 87.1% red, 12.9%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.1% magenta, 50.9%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 335.9 degrees, a saturation of 74.1% and a lightness of 50%. #de216d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ff42da with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

● #de216d color description : Vivid pink.
The hexadecimal color #de216d has RGB values of R:222, G:33,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.51,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14557549.
